Can an exhaust leak cause a misfire Misfires directly due to exhaust leaks aren't very common but are a probable cause The most common causes of misfires and backfires are due to misadjustment of the ignition timing or valve timing Wrong reports to the pcm from the leak, however, can cause a misfire.

In conclusion, while a bad exhaust system may not directly cause a car to misfire, it can contribute to conditions that increase the likelihood of misfires occurring The disruption of backpressure, the introduction of unfiltered air, and damage to exhaust valves are all potential mechanisms by which a malfunctioning exhaust can trigger misfires.
